Aimer is one of the most common French verbs. It is a regular -ER verb, requires
avoir
in the compound tenses, and can mean “to like” or “to love.” There is a little bit of a trick to using aimer correctly with people and direct object pronouns which you will learn about in this lesson.

How do you use Aimer as a verb?
- J’aime (ehm)
- Tu aimes (ehm)
- Il/Elle/ On aime (ehm)
- Nous aimons (ehmohn)
- Vous aimez (ehmay)
- Ils/ Elles aiment (ehm) Note that the je contracts before a vowel to j’.

What is avoir?
Avoir is one of the two most important French verbs (être is the other one) and has irregular conjugations in just about every tense and mood. Avoir literally
means “to have
,” but also serves an an auxiliary verb and is found in many idiomatic expressions.
Is manger avoir or etre?
Manger is
a regular French -er verb
, but it is also a spelling-change verb. This means that it takes all the regular -er endings, but a small spelling change is made to the stem for consistency of pronunciation. The stem: the infinitive manger minus the -er ending, which leaves the stem mang-.

Is parler a word?
Parler is
the infinitive form of the verb
, or the basic, generic form. When we use it with a pronoun such as je to say ‘I speak,’ we use the appropriate form or conjugation: je parle.
